Weather in July

July, the same as June, in Sykes, Mississippi, is another hot summer month, with an average temperature ranging between min 71.8°F (22.1°C) and max 91.9°F (33.3°C).

Temperature

With an average high-temperature of 91.9°F (33.3°C) and an average low-temperature of 71.8°F (22.1°C), July is the warmest month.

Heat index

The heat index value during July is computed to be a burning hot 116.6°F (47°C). Keep on guard: Heat exhaustion and heat cramps are probable. Heatstroke is a possible danger with ongoing physical activity.
Heat index specifics point out values are for conditions of shade and a slight breeze. Exposure to the sun directly might heighten the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'feels like' or 'felt air temperature', is found by incorporating humidity levels into the air temperature measurement. The effect is experienced differently by individuals, hinging on unique characteristics such as body mass, stature, and level of activity. When in direct sunlight, one should be cautious as it can raise the heat index by as much as 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values hold particular significance for children. Children often miss understanding the importance of rest and rehydration. Thirst usually appears late during dehydration - therefore, maintaining hydration, particularly during long physical activities, is essential.
Perspiration is the body's default response to elevated temperatures, as it promotes the evaporation of sweat to achieve cooling. In conditions of both high temperature and humidity (a high heat index), sweating is limited and the perception of heat is enhanced. Rising body temperatures due to excess heat retention could signify impending heat disorders.

Humidity

The average relative humidity in July is 75%.

Rainfall

In Sykes, Mississippi, in July, it is raining for 21.7 days, with typically 3.74" (95mm) of accumulated precipitation. In Sykes, during the entire year, the rain falls for 165.6 days and collects up to 36.06" (916mm) of precipitation.

Snowfall

April through November are months without snowfall in Sykes.

Daylight

In Sykes, the average length of the day in July is 14h and 1min.
On the first day of July in Sykes, sunrise is at 5:52 am and sunset at 8:04 pm.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 6:09 am and sunset at 7:52 pm CDT.

Sunshine

In Sykes, Mississippi, the average sunshine in July is 10.3h.

UV index

June through August, with an average maximum UV index of 7, are months with the highest UV index in Sykes. A UV Index of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high health risk from exposure to the Sun's UV radiation for the ordinary person.
Note: In July, the UV index of 7 transforms into the following advice:
Guard oneself from overexposure. Defence against sun injury is vital. Make an effort to avoid direct sun exposure between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m., the peak period for UV radiation, and note that objects like parasols or canopies might not offer full sun protection. Select sunglasses that boast both UVA and UVB protection to limit the adverse effects of the sun on the eyes.
